Gloyd Family Foundation

PEORIA, IL EIN: 36-4140796

Gloyd Family Foundation is a nonprofit organization focused on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, based in PEORIA, IL.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. In 2024, it awarded 30 grants totaling $205K.

Among its reported 2024 grants, the largest include Westminster Presbyterian Church ($30,000), Rosecrance ($25,000), Family Peace Center ($15,000).
